Brazil to Tanzania by Air freight

The quickest way to get from Brazil to Tanzania by plane will take about 18h 22m and departs from Guarulhos - Governador André Franco Montoro International Airport (GRU) and arrives into Julius Nyerere International Airport (DAR). There are flights departing 1-2 times a day on this route. South African Airways is one of the carriers that operates regular services on this route with flights departing 2-4 times a week.

Brazil to Tanzania by Container ship

The quickest way to get from Brazil to Tanzania by ship will take about 38 days 15h and departs from Navegantes (BRNVT) and arrives into Dar es Salaam (TZDAR). There are vessels departing 1-2 times a week on this route. ONE is one of the carriers that operates regular services on this route with vessels departing every 1-2 weeks.
